They shed light on how irregular rainfall patterns affect soil infiltration, runoff, and groundwater recharge, all of which underpin agricultural productivity, biodiversity, and climate resilience.\n<\/p>\n<h2>The Mechanics of Wild Rain: Interactions with the Atmosphere and Land<\/h2>\n<p>\nIn cases of vigorous atmospheric convection \u2014 such as thunderstorms caused by convective cells or orographic uplift \u2014 rain particles are propelled into turbulent zones, creating irregular droplet formations and drop size distributions. These processes are critically studied through complex atmospheric physics models, which track variables like humidity, temperature, wind shear, and aerosol interactions.\n<\/p>\n<p>\nRecent research indicates that the morphology and distribution of raindrops under &#8220;wild&#8221; conditions significantly influence surface runoff patterns. Larger droplets tend to lead to greater soil erosion, while lighter, more dispersed rain promotes infiltration. The variability is driven by microphysical processes within cloud systems, which are influenced by volatile environmental factors.\n<\/p>\n<h2>Scientific Insights into Precipitation Variability<\/h2>\n<p>\nTo illustrate the complexity, consider the following data derived from recent climatological analyses:\n<\/p>\n<table>\n<thead>\n<tr style=\"background-color:#c0f0f0;\">\n<th>Precipitation Type<\/th>\n<th>Drop Size Range (mm)<\/th>\n<th>Impact on Soil Infiltration<\/th>\n<th>Associated Atmospheric Conditions<\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td>Convective Rain<\/td>\n<td>2.0 \u2013 5.0<\/td>\n<td>Low to moderate infiltration; high erosion risk<\/td>\n<td>Strong upward air currents, unstable atmosphere<\/td>\n<\/tr>\n<tr>\n<td>Stratiform Rain<\/td>\n<td>0.5 \u2013 2.0<\/td>\n<td>High infiltration; less erosion<\/td>\n<td>Stable, layered cloud structures<\/td>\n<\/tr>\n<tr>\n<td>Unusual or &#8220;Wild&#8221; Rain Events<\/td>\n<td>Varies (&lt;0.5 \u2013 &gt;5.0)<\/td>\n<td>Highly variable effects, often unpredictable<\/td>\n<td>Turbulence, aerosol interactions, rapidly changing humidity<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p>\nThese variations are critical for hydrologists aiming to model flood risks and land degradation under climate change scenarios.
